.inquiry h2{font-size:2.6rem;font-weight:700;letter-spacing:.5rem;margin:0 0 5rem;position:relative;text-align:center}.inquiry h2:before{background-color:#19a7ce;bottom:-.7rem;content:"";height:.5rem;left:50%;position:absolute;transform:translateX(-50%);width:25rem}.inquiry__block{background:#fff;padding:2rem}.inquiry .wpcf7-textarea,.inquiry input[type=email],.inquiry input[type=tel],.inquiry input[type=text]{border:.1rem solid #ccc;border-radius:.4rem;color:#333;font-size:1.4rem;font-weight:400;margin:.5rem 0;padding:1rem;width:100%}.inquiry .wpcf7-textarea::-moz-placeholder,.inquiry input[type=email]::-moz-placeholder,.inquiry input[type=tel]::-moz-placeholder,.inquiry input[type=text]::-moz-placeholder{color:#afafaf;font-weight:400;opacity:1}.inquiry .wpcf7-textarea::placeholder,.inquiry input[type=email]::placeholder,.inquiry input[type=tel]::placeholder,.inquiry input[type=text]::placeholder{color:#afafaf;font-weight:400;opacity:1}.inquiry .btn{height:5rem;position:relative}.inquiry .btn .wpcf7-spinner{display:none}.inquiry .btn input[type=submit]{background:#f57500;border-radius:.4rem;color:#fff;display:block;font-size:1.5rem;font-weight:700;left:50%;margin:0 auto;padding:1rem;position:absolute;text-align:center;top:50%;transform:translate(-50%,-50%);width:60%}.inquiry .btn input[type=submit]:active{opacity:.6}.inquiry .labelbox{margin:0 0 1.5rem}.inquiry .labelbox .nameblock{display:flex;justify-content:space-between}.inquiry .labelbox .nameblock__left{color:#888;font-size:1.4rem;font-weight:700;margin:0;width:48%}.inquiry .labelbox .member{border-bottom:2px solid #888;border-top:2px solid #888;margin:0 0 2rem;padding:15px 0}.inquiry .labelbox .member .required{color:#ff2300;font-size:12px}.inquiry .labelbox .member .any{color:#0080ff;font-size:12px}.inquiry [data-class=wpcf7cf_group]{display:block!important}.inquiry .required{color:#ff2300;font-size:14px}.inquiry .any{color:#0080ff;font-size:14px}.inquiry .label{display:block;font-size:16px;font-weight:700;margin:0 0 5px}.inquiry .memberlabel{color:#888;display:block;font-size:14px;font-weight:700;margin:0 10px 10px 0}.inquiry .kanamemnameblock,.inquiry .memnameblock,.inquiry .nameblock{display:flex;justify-content:space-between}.inquiry .kanamemnameblock__left,.inquiry .kanamemnameblock__right,.inquiry .memnameblock__left,.inquiry .memnameblock__right,.inquiry .nameblock__left,.inquiry .nameblock__right{color:#888;font-size:14px;font-weight:700;margin:0;width:48%}.inquiry .kanamemnameblock__left,.inquiry .kanamemnameblock__right,.inquiry .membersex,.inquiry .memnameblock__left,.inquiry .memnameblock__right{color:#888;font-size:14px;font-weight:700;margin:0 0 5px}.inquiry .membersex .wpcf7-list-item{border:.1rem solid #ccc;border-radius:4px;font-size:14px!important;padding:1rem!important}.inquiry .membersex .wpcf7-list-item.first{margin:.5rem 0}.inquiry .membersex .wpcf7-form-control{border-radius:4px!important;padding:0!important}@media screen and (min-width:1025px){.container{background:#fff;margin:4rem auto 0;max-width:100rem;padding:5rem 3rem}.inquiry{margin:0 auto;max-width:80rem}.inquiry .textbox p{font-size:1.5rem}.inquiry__block{padding:4rem 4rem 0}.inquiry .btn{margin-top:3rem}.inquiry .btn input[type=submit]{font-size:1.5rem;padding:1.5rem 2rem;width:40%}.inquiry .btn input[type=submit]:hover{opacity:.6}.inquiry .labelbox .nameblock__left{font-size:1.4rem}.inquiry .labelbox .member .required{color:#ff2300;font-size:14px}.inquiry .labelbox .member .any{color:#0080ff;font-size:14px}.inquiry .required{color:#ff2300;font-size:1.4rem}.inquiry .any{color:#0080ff;font-size:1.4rem}.inquiry .label{font-size:1.8rem}.inquiry .memberlabel{font-size:1.6rem}.inquiry .kanamemnameblock__left,.inquiry .kanamemnameblock__right,.inquiry .memnameblock__left,.inquiry .memnameblock__right,.inquiry .nameblock__left,.inquiry .nameblock__right{font-size:1.4 rem}.inquiry .kanamemnameblock__left,.inquiry .kanamemnameblock__right,.inquiry .membersex,.inquiry .memnameblock__left,.inquiry .memnameblock__right{font-size:1.4rem;margin:0 0 1rem}.inquiry .membersex .wpcf7-list-item{font-size:1.6rem!important}}